Định nghĩa – Cấu hình thiết bị được kết nối (CDC) có nghĩa là gì?

Cấu hình thiết bị được kết nối (CDC) là một bộ các tiêu chuẩn, thư viện và các tính năng của máy ảo làm cơ sở cho các giao diện lập trình ứng dụng (API) nhắm vào người tiêu dùng và các thiết bị nhúng như giao tiếp thông minh, PDA cao cấp và hộp set-top. CDC hỗ trợ ba bộ API được gọi là hồ sơ nền tảng, hồ sơ cơ sở cá nhân và hồ sơ cá nhân.

Là một phần của Phiên bản Java Platform Micro (Java ME), CDC được thiết kế cho các thiết bị cầm tay và hệ thống nhúng. Đặc biệt, nó được xây dựng cho các thiết bị có tài nguyên tốt hơn (như RAM và bộ nhớ lưu trữ) so với các thiết bị được hỗ trợ bởi cấu hình thiết bị giới hạn được kết nối (CLDC). CDC có thể hoạt động với các thiết bị được điều khiển bởi bộ vi xử lý / bộ điều khiển 32 bit với RAM 2 MB có sẵn và ROM 2, 5 MB cho môi trường Java.

Techopedia giải thích Cấu hình thiết bị được kết nối (CDC)

Cấu hình thiết bị được liên kết ( CDC ) là một bộ những tiêu chuẩn, thư viện và những tính năng của máy ảo làm cơ sở cho những giao diện lập trình ứng dụng ( API ) nhắm vào người tiêu dùng và những thiết bị nhúng như tiếp xúc mưu trí, PDA hạng sang và hộp set-top. CDC tương hỗ ba bộ API được gọi là hồ sơ nền tảng, hồ sơ cơ sở cá thể và hồ sơ cá thể. Là một phần của Phiên bản Java Platform Micro ( Java ME ), CDC được phong cách thiết kế cho những thiết bị cầm tay và mạng lưới hệ thống nhúng. Đặc biệt, nó được thiết kế xây dựng cho những thiết bị có tài nguyên tốt hơn ( như RAM và bộ nhớ tàng trữ ) so với những thiết bị được tương hỗ bởi thông số kỹ thuật thiết bị số lượng giới hạn được liên kết ( CLDC ). CDC hoàn toàn có thể hoạt động giải trí với những thiết bị được điều khiển và tinh chỉnh bởi bộ vi giải quyết và xử lý / bộ tinh chỉnh và điều khiển 32 bit với RAM 2 MB có sẵn và ROM 2, 5 MB cho môi trường tự nhiên Java .

Java ME được cung cấp cho các nhà phát triển dưới dạng các bộ API được gọi là cấu hình, cấu hình và các gói tùy chọn. Một cấu hình là lớn nhất của các bộ này. Nó phục vụ cho một loạt các thiết bị tương đối rộng. Hồ sơ phục vụ cho một phạm vi hẹp hơn của các thiết bị. Mặt khác, các gói tùy chọn là các API thêm chức năng cho các ứng dụng và phục vụ cho các công nghệ cụ thể.

Ba bộ API của CDC thực hiện như sau:

  1. Cấu hình nền tảng: Dành cho các thiết bị không có GUI. Nó có một thư viện dựa trên J2SE và hỗ trợ một số gói tùy chọn bảo mật, chẳng hạn như Dịch vụ xác thực và xác thực Java, Tiện ích mở rộng ổ cắm bảo mật Java và Tiện ích mở rộng mã hóa Java.
  2. Cấu hình cơ sở cá nhân: Bao gồm API cấu hình nền tảng và dành cho các thiết bị có GUI nhẹ. Một số lớp công cụ cửa sổ trừu tượng (AWT) cũng được hỗ trợ. Các ứng dụng dựa trên mô hình lập trình ứng dụng Xlet. Các nhà phát triển viết nội dung cho các đĩa Blu-Ray sử dụng hồ sơ này.
  3. Cấu hình cá nhân: Dành cho các thiết bị di động cao cấp và đã hỗ trợ bộ công cụ GUI dựa trên AWT. Tất cả các ứng dụng được xây dựng dựa trên hồ sơ này đều dựa trên mô hình lập trình applet.

Các gói tùy chọn khác, có thể hoạt động trên CDC, bao gồm:

  1. Gói tùy chọn RMI: Dành cho ứng dụng phân tán và truyền thông mạng.
  2. Gói tùy chọn JDBC: được sử dụng để kết nối với các nguồn dữ liệu như bảng tính, tệp phẳng và cơ sở dữ liệu quan hệ.

Để lại một bình luận

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*